Change Grow Live is seeking a full-time Administrator Receptionist based in Coventry. The role involves providing essential administrative support and serving as the first point of contact for service users.
Responsibilities include:
- Managing interactions
- Taking minutes
- Maintaining records
Ideal candidates will have strong IT skills, interpersonal abilities, and experience in office procedures.
Employees enjoy 25 days annual leave, flexible working, and development opportunities, with a salary of £26,091 per annum.

How to prepare for a job interview at Change Grow Live
✨Know Your Role Inside Out
Before the interview, make sure you thoroughly understand the responsibilities of an Administrator Receptionist. Familiarise yourself with the key tasks like managing interactions and taking minutes. This will help you demonstrate your knowledge and show that you're genuinely interested in the role.
✨Show Off Your IT Skills
Since strong IT skills are a must for this position, be prepared to discuss your experience with various software and tools. Bring examples of how you've used technology to improve efficiency in previous roles. If you can, practice using common office software beforehand to feel confident during the interview.
✨Highlight Your Interpersonal Abilities
As the first point of contact for service users, your interpersonal skills are crucial. Think of specific examples where you've successfully managed interactions or resolved conflicts. This will help you illustrate your ability to communicate effectively and create a welcoming environment.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the team dynamics, opportunities for development, or what a typical day looks like. This shows your enthusiasm for the role and helps you gauge if the company culture aligns with your values.
